Skip to content

Commit 761f4dd

Browse files
committed
start.joininbox: check cpu architecture
1 parent 195b4a6 commit 761f4dd

1 file changed

Lines changed: 12 additions & 4 deletions

File tree

scripts/start.joininbox.sh

Lines changed: 12 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-10,8 +10,8 @@ if [ -f /home/joinmarket/joinin.conf ]; then
1010
fi
1111

1212
# get settings on first run
13-
runningEnv=$(grep -c "runningEnv" < /home/joinmarket/joinin.conf)
14-
if [ "$runningEnv" -eq 0 ]; then
13+
runningEnvEntry=$(grep -c "runningEnv" < /home/joinmarket/joinin.conf)
14+
if [ "$runningEnvEntry" -eq 0 ]; then
1515
if [ -f "/mnt/hdd/raspiblitz.conf" ] ; then
1616
runningEnv="raspiblitz"
1717
setupStep=100
@@ -24,15 +24,23 @@ if [ "$runningEnv" -eq 0 ]; then
2424
echo "# running in the environment: $runningEnv"
2525

2626
# make sure Tor path is known
27-
checkDirEntry=$(grep -c "HiddenServiceDir" < /home/joinmarket/joinin.conf)
28-
if [ "$checkDirEntry" -eq 0 ]; then
27+
DirEntry=$(grep -c "HiddenServiceDir" < /home/joinmarket/joinin.conf)
28+
if [ "$DirEntry" -eq 0 ]; then
2929
if [ -d "/mnt/hdd/tor" ] ; then
3030
HiddenServiceDir="/mnt/hdd/tor"
3131
else
3232
HiddenServiceDir="/var/lib/tor"
3333
fi
3434
echo "HiddenServiceDir=$HiddenServiceDir" >> /home/joinmarket/joinin.conf
3535
fi
36+
37+
# identify cpu architecture
38+
cpuEntry=$(grep -c "cpu" < /home/joinmarket/joinin.conf)
39+
if [ "$cpuEntry" -eq 0 ]; then
40+
cpu=$(sudo uname -m)
41+
echo "# cpu=${cpu}"
42+
echo "cpu=$cpu" >> /home/joinmarket/joinin.conf
43+
fi
3644
fi
3745

3846
source /home/joinmarket/joinin.conf

0 commit comments

Comments
 (0)